As per the statement:
Maritza's car has 16 gallons of gas in the tank. She uses 3/4 of the gas.
⇒Total gas in her car = 16 gallons
and
She used = [tex]\frac{3}{4}[/tex] of the total gas
Then;
Maritza's car uses = [tex]\frac{3}{4} \times 16 = 3 \times 4 = 12[/tex] gallons
Therefore, 12 gallons of gas does Maritza use.
